Hunting Nebraska
Iam wondering if any of you guys have hunted there. Iam thinking about taking my son out there for the muzzleloader season. If so how is it for non res. to get permission. Or is the public area ok. Any info. is ok. Thanks

Well i live in Nebraska. I like hunting here theres alot of big bucks if you can find em.
here the game and park website if you want to read up on anything. http://www.ngpc.state.ne.us/homepage.html
The price for an nonresident tag is, 150 bucks. I don't knwo if you need to buy Nebraska habitat stamps and stuff, if you do here is the prices, 10 bucks for the habitat stamp. So 160 bucks to hunt deer. Do you know where you would like to hunt? I suggest either out west or or the southeast part. I don't know how the people are around the western part but alot of people will be happy to like you hunt they want the deer outa there. There are GOOD bucks out in the western part. I would say it would be easier to hunt the wester part cause of the canyons just set up on top and your good. My uncle has come out with a great buck everyyear out west. The southeast part the people are pretty good with letting you hunt. I suggest going around Hubble and farther east. but anywhere around southeast is good the more woods the better. the big bucks are hard to find but there there. word of warning not to scare you off or anything. There are mountain lions here, they are illegal to shoot unless you are threatened by one, so just keep an eye open.
